WebMay 12, 2024 · Venous leg ulcers (VLUs) are open lesions of the lower limb and represent between 60 and 80% of all leg ulcerations that occur in the presence of venous disease [ 1, 2 ]. Healing rates are protracted with only 60% on average healed by 12 weeks, and once healed, 75% develop a recurrence within 3 weeks [ 3 ].
